What is an entry level simulator?

Entry level simulator jobs typically involve operating or assisting with simulation equipment used for training or research purposes in industries such as aviation, healthcare, or engineering. Individuals in these roles may help set up simulation scenarios, monitor trainee performance, and maintain simulation hardware and software. These jobs usually require basic technical skills, attention to detail, and the ability to follow protocols. They provide valuable experience for those looking to advance in fields that rely on simulation-based training or analysis.

What are the key skills and qualifications needed to thrive as an entry level simulator?

To thrive as an Entry Level Simulator, you typically need a background in computer science, engineering, or a related field, with knowledge of simulation principles and data analysis. Familiarity with simulation software such as MATLAB, Simulink, or Arena, and sometimes certifications in relevant software, are often required. Strong problem-solving skills, attention to detail, and effective communication help you collaborate with teams and interpret simulation results. These skills ensure accurate simulations, valuable insights, and support the development or testing of real-world systems.

What are the most common challenges faced by entry level simulator operators when learning to use new simulation software?

Entry-level simulator operators often encounter challenges such as understanding complex simulation interfaces, adapting to rapidly changing technology, and mastering scenario setup and troubleshooting. It's common to feel overwhelmed at first, but most teams provide thorough onboarding and mentorship to help new hires build confidence. Actively seeking feedback and collaborating with more experienced team members can greatly accelerate your learning curve and professional growth.

Applied AI Engineer(EDA), Platform Architecture

Austin, Texas, United States Machine Learning and AI

Description

In this role, you will focus on AI based automations, infrastructure development, and continuous experimentation at the intersection of hardware design and verification.

Responsibilities
  • Design and deploy autonomous AI agents to review design changes, resolve conflicts, and triage elaboration and simulation errors.
  • Develop AI-driven workflows to flag simulation performance and design concerns, automatically tune design parameters, and explore optimization candidates autonomously.
  • Apply internal and external EDA tools (e.g. Logic Equivalence Checking, wave dumps, design libraries) to automatically diagnose issues and explore design alternatives.
  • Build and maintain AI harnesses, scripts, and infrastructure to support continuous research and experimentation.
  • Conduct data-driven experimentation to optimize prompts and harnesses; measure and improve token efficiency, task completion, and hallucination rates.
  • Track and evaluate emerging machine learning and Large Language Model (LLM) use cases in the broader industry for application in silicon design workflows.
  • Occasionally travel (approximately once a year) to collaborate with development groups in the US.
Minimum Qualifications
  • Bachelor’s degree in Computer Science, Electrical Engineering, Machine Learning, or a related field (or equivalent practical experience).
  • Experience in one of the following two areas: Applied AI (experience building, deploying, and maintaining LLM-based applications, agentic workflows, or advanced prompt engineering, combined with an entry-level familiarity with EDA tools or hardware verification concepts), or EDA/Silicon (experience with RTL design, simulation, or hardware emulation platforms, combined with a demonstrated track record of working in research-oriented roles applying software automation or ML to hardware problems).
  • Experience with scripting, infrastructure development, and software engineering (e.g. Python, C/C++).
Preferred Qualifications
  • Master’s in Computer Science, Electrical Engineering, or a related AI/Hardware field.
  • Hands‑on experience with Design Verification tasks requiring application of EDA tools, including Logic Equivalence Checking (LEC), linting / static analysis tools, waveform debugging, and simulation / emulation flows.
  • Familiarity with Verilog, SystemVerilog, or architecting HDL testbenches for functional verification.
  • Experience developing software tools for co‑simulating designs across multiple high‑performance platforms.
  • Comfortable exploring unfamiliar codebases, researching cutting‑edge techniques, and rapidly prototyping automated solutions.
  • Experience applying research methods: literature review, data‑driven experimentation, analyzing results.
  • Strong communication skills, with the ability to collaborate effectively with cross‑functional silicon engineering, design verification, and EDA development teams.
